About the Role

DesignAgency is an international studio specializing in interior design, architectural concepting, strategic branding, and visual communications. Since its beginnings in 1998, the firm has become a global leader in the development of transformative spaces and brands, with projects in more than 60 cities across 18 countries. With a lead studio in Toronto, and offices in Washington, D.C., Los Angeles, and Barcelona, DesignAgency works with leading hotels and resorts, restaurateurs, entrepreneurs, and developers, leveraging talent, expertise, and the power of collaboration to deliver extraordinary experiences that create lasting value.

DesignAgency depends on Interns to carry out elements of projects; generally under the supervision of Senior Designers or Project Designers. Interns collaborate with others to produce excellent drawings, details and documentation. They consult with their teams to solve design, technical, production, scope or client issues of which they become aware. The firm relies on them to develop excellent working relationships with their colleagues in the studio. 

Interns report to Senior Designers, Project Designers, or others as assigned. 

Roles and Responsibilities 

To be considered, an Intern should demonstrate exceptional skills in the following areas: 

Design 

  • Clear ability to carry out components of projects under supervision and direction of design teams 
  • Imaginative, consistent and engaged 
  • Demonstrate real curiosity about design trends, issues, materials and products 
  • Participation in the design dialogue 
  • Show continued increase in quality in their drawings and documentation, and client service 
  • Conceive and design smaller elements of projects, as directed 
  • Develop high-quality drawings, details and documentation that are clear, accurate, comprehensive, and consistent 
  • Assist in the creation of visualizations, samples, demonstration boards and models
  • Assist in product and materials research 
  • Produce and maintain high quality minutes, memos, and orders 
  • Learn and apply building regulations and codes 
  • Learn and apply tendering and contracting processes and standards 
  • Learn and apply construction technique and materials characteristics 
  • Strive to reduce rework, errors, and omissions 

Leadership

  • Proactively share design knowledge with other team members 
  • Create sound relationships with colleagues and positively contribute to studio culture

Management 

  • Demonstrate excellent personal time management 

Qualifications 

  • Currently enrolled in a post-secondary program for Interior Design, Architecture, or equivalent
  • Educational and/or work experience using AutoCAD and Revit (SketchUp, Illustrator, Photoshop and InDesign are beneficial). 

These are the minimal requirements for this position, with all other experience being advantages for the successful candidate.

A portfolio or work samples must be included in your application.
